Output 08ddd43be1795517c7fd040fded9e18c46052534d88770c11c8780a815be7a6d:0

value
23397567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3571df84d72e3e4f4acb820f776b7f0e2a90eb9a OP_EQUAL
address
36Zc9kgP2W2bP2QArLyqyac27qfNQeYaEk
transaction
08ddd43be1795517c7fd040fded9e18c46052534d88770c11c8780a815be7a6d
spent
true